I have one of the recent moscow concerts, but I lent it to a friend. When I
get it back (maybe Friday) I can put it somewhere for easy download. Email
me if you are interested in the link. Sparks played June 1st and 2nd at a
little club (approx 1400 people) called the Apelsin in Moscow. The show I
have is from June 2nd. 

This was the set list:

01 Sparks Show (intro)
02 Happy Hunting Ground
03 Something For The Girl With Everything
04 Bon Voyage
05 In The Future
06 Tryouts For The Human Race
07 The Number 1 Song In Heaven
08 Never Turn Your Back On Mother Earth
09 -laughing-
10 Music You Can Dance To
11 Pineapple
12 Dick Around
13 Perfume
14 Waterproof
15 When Do I Get To Sing "My Way"?
16 This Town Ain't Big Enough For Both Of Us
17 Amateur Hour
18 Aeroflot
19 Suburban Homeboy
20 Change
21 Dick Around (piano version)
